Distance From Brits Airport to Narita International Airport

The distance from Brits Airport () to Narita International Airport (NRT) is 8446 miles or 13592 kilometers or 7334 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Brits ( South Africa ) to Narita ( Japan )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Brits and Narita takes around 19 hours 25 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Brits Airport, Brits, South Africa to Narita International Airport, Narita, Japan is 19 hours 25 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
